The way to set this up is to have a shared inline function in
i2c-omap.h that both the driver and hwmod code can use.
hwmod reset function uses oh (omap_hwmod).

How could the driver also pass oh ?
Could we keep a local copy in driver data?
quoted
Eventually hwmod code will do the reset only in late initcall
if no driver is loaded for the device in question.
There's no need for the driver to know anything about oh.
The driver just needs to know the iobase.
